If you ordered your car in the US it should have the silver footrest as pictured on the BMW builder.

My car is US Spec and has the same configuration options as I bought it in the US. I mentioned to my dealer about the footrest and he stated that there is a BMW bulletin stating that beige interiors do not have the footrest. I asked about the configuration and they should change the pic online. What options do I have to get the footrest? This was all after the fact and BMW never stated that I would not get it. In fact, I have my purchase order stating the M Sport package and I was expecting all the options. Shouldn't BMW put one in for me? What do you guys think?

Strangely enough, despite being a different factory, a different car, a different dealer, and 2,650 miles further west, it took exactly 73 days from order to delivery both the first and second time I've ordered a 335i.

Part 1

I came out of an E92 M3 this time. There are so many unique differences about the F30 - for better or for worse; I am just thrilled.

Took delivery this morning, so everything is still very, very fresh. But here's some quick notes:
  • The 6MT is very notchy. The distance between gears is tiny. So at first, it is different and feels strange; but once you get in rhythm it shifts excellently.
  • Headreasts are insanely improved - Cushioned, soft, and my head actually rests on them now!
  • The sport seats are perfect, just like before.
  • Comfort mode with M Adaptive suspension is "bouncy" in a very, very good way. I have never driven a three series which I could describe in this way until now.
  • Eco pro is excellent on the highway, Reminds you when you forget to shift because you're busy doing other things you shouldn't be doing
  • Harmon Kardon is somewhat tinny and average from it's first impression - Definitely need to play with the settings & hoping there's improvement to be made.
  • Seeing those beautiful angel eyes reflecting the first time will give you a nice little chill
  • The navi screen is positioned wonderfully, as well as the iDrive controller.
  • M Sport steering wheel! PERFECT.
  • The F30 is BIG. At least it feels that way. Maybe I am more biased coming out of two E92s, but everything feels huge. This is what I was expecting & looking forward to, so it's a very welcome change for me.
  • ASS is great as well. Not sure why everyone is complaining? It inconspicuously turns off when your car is ... stopped. Then turns back on the second your foot touches the clutch. Yay gas savings.
  • Estoril Blue II is unbelievable in person. Pictures simply do not do this color justice. Really, go see it for yourself.
